将SVG转换为PDF时,TCPDF自定义字体问题

3
我已经使用以下代码将所有字体导入到tcpdf中:

TCPDF_FONTS::addTTFfont($ttf, 'TrueTypeUnicode', '', 96);

现在我正在将全尺寸的SVG图像转换为PDF页面:

$pdf->ImageSVG('@' . $svg, 0, 0, $width, $height, '', '', '', 0,
false);

我在所有文本的末尾都得到了三个正方形,如何去掉它们? Bug 链接到svg:http://files.dangerd.org/pub/zzz/test.svg
1个回答

1
在当前的TCPDF源代码中,您可以取消注释第24418行。
$text = $this->stringTrim($text);

这对我很有帮助,但我没有进行全面测试,也不知道为什么它首先被注释掉了。

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接